> As reported by Denis Garyachy on the list (see
> TEST-org.hibernate.test.collection.CollectionTest.txt of testout.tgz in the
> Hibernate unit tests report), SQL Server can use bracketed identifiers
> instead of quoted identifiers. So a table name can look like [Users] instead
> of "Users".
> We already added a workaround for MySQL's backtick so we should add the same
> for brackets.
> I attached a patch which should fix the problem (not tested as I don't have
> any access to a SQL Server DB).
